Position overview

The Research Fellow 1 (RF1) is a research professional responsible for working collaboratively with both internal and external project stakeholders to enable the delivery of quality research and project outcomes. The Research Fellow 2 (RF2) will also assume responsibility for managing projects including the supervision of project team members. 

 

Position context

The Specialist Professional Education and Research (SPEAR) team, within ACER’s Tertiary and Professional Education Research (TaPER) program, applies highly specialised knowledge and skills to enhance assessment quality across a diverse range of medical, health and other professions. To support its continued growth, SPEAR is seeking a Research Fellow on a 12-month fixed-term contract, with the potential for extension, to contribute their specialised expertise.

 

This position will work directly with clients, including colleges in the medical, health and other professions, and will support senior researchers to manage and deliver projects within the program.
